"'She's Single Again'" is a song written by Peter McCann and Charlie Craig and recorded by American country music artist Janie Fricke. It was released in May 1985 as the first single from the album 'Somebody Else's Fire'. The song reached #2 on the 'Billboard' Hot Country Singles chart. The song was also recorded by Reba McEntire for her 1985 album, 'Have I Got a Deal for You'. Fricke released the song as a single before McEntire could, despite the potential that Reba saw for the song. This situation almost happened again the following year, when Fricke was almost offered the song Little Rock, McEntire's producers talked it over with Fricke's producers and McEntire took the single to #1 on the country charts in 1986.
